> While driving my 1993 buick lesabre limited one day, I smelled a strong
> electrical burning smell. Later that evening I noticed that my
> instrument panel back lights went out and my brake lights don't work
> either. When my lights are turned on only my headlights work and
> nothing else. I have read that sometimes the turn signal lever could
> produce this problem but my turn signals work ok, in fact they are the
> only lights that work in the rear. Any help on this issue?
>
If you burned up some wiring, you should still be able to smell it and
you'll need to use your nose a bit to try to find it. It's kind of straight
forward - you smelled burning and you lights quit working... now you have
to find the damaged wires, and from there figure out what caused the over
current condition. It could be something as simple as mice having eaten
through insulation which created a path to ground, or it could be something
in the circuit has failed. No way to tell without getting your head in
there. Have you recently done anything like add a stereo, or in any other
way messed with the wiring?
